Cabinet Mission Proposal for Constituent Assembly

The formation of a constituent assembly to draft India's Constitution was a key objective following World War II.

Several proposals were considered, but the specific plan that successfully outlined the process for electing members to a constituent assembly came from the British Cabinet Mission.

Key Mission Details

  • The Cabinet Mission Plan of 1946 was sent to India to discuss the transfer of power from the British government to the Indian leadership.
  • This mission proposed a scheme for the creation of a Constituent Assembly.
  • The goal was to draft the Constitution of India.
  • The plan suggested a three-tier structure: provinces, princely states, and chief commissioner provinces would form the basis of the assembly.

Therefore, the Cabinet Mission Plan of 1946 is recognized for proposing the constituent assembly to frame the Constitution of India.
